#bfd3de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bfd3de is composed of 74.9% red, 82.7%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14% cyan, 5%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 201.3 degrees, a saturation of 32% and a lightness of 81%. #bfd3de color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7fa7bd.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#bfd3de color description : Light grayish blue.
#bfd3de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bfd3de has RGB values of R:191, G:211,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0.05,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 12571614.
